Piecki-Migowo

Piecki-Migowo is one of the quarters of the city of Gdansk (German:Danzig), which consists of 2 parts: Piecki and Migowo. Populated by 23,593 inhabitants in an area 3.8 kmē (population density 6,224). Piecki-Migowo together are popularly called The Morena and are located on the top of the hill over 100 meters above sea level, that used to be an example of Arcadian nature. Nevertheless, it is an example of multi-story housing estate that failed to properly use the beauty of the landscape.

The housing estate was built in the second half of 1970's and 1980's. The construction areas are slowly extended to the area of the former military poligoons. Prevailing type of new housing are family houses or small buildings.

The Morena is charactarized by a very cold and extremely windy climate in sharp contrast with neighbouring areas of Gdansk. However, the pollution in the atmosphere is virtually nonexistent due to the sea breeze of over 40 km per hour.

The hill is connected by convenient bicycle route with Wrzeszcz.
